Rob Greer is Vice President and General Manager of the Network Information Security Division at Broadcom (NIS). In this role, he is responsible for the go-to-market, product management, product development and cloud service delivery functions behind Symantec’s market leading data loss prevention (DLP) and secure web gateway (SWG) product franchises.

Mr. Greer joined the company through the Symantec Enterprise Security business acquisition, where he was most recently Vice President of the Information Security Group. Prior to this role, he was a senior executive at Forescout Technologies where he played a key role in taking the company public and growing the business four-fold over his tenure. Prior to Forescout, he was Vice President and General Manager of the HP TippingPoint enterprise network security business. Before HP, Mr. Greer was an executive at Symantec for four years and led a number of functions during his tenure, including the enterprise mobility business as well as the core security, endpoint management and data loss prevention (DLP) businesses. Previously, Mr. Greer was Vice President of Worldwide Systems Engineering for SonicWALL which he joined through the company’s acquisition of Ignyte Technology where he was founder and Chief Executive Officer. Mr., Greer holds a B.A. in Business Administration with a concentration in Management Information Systems from San Jose State University.
